In this episode, Abhay Rao & Balaji Rao share insights on 3 major updates shaping India’s real estate and related markets: 🟢 Supreme Court Verdict on Speculative Investors The Supreme Court clarifies that speculative investors cannot use insolvency proceedings under the IBC to recover their money, emphasizing project-specific resolution over corporate-wide claims. What does this mean for real estate investors and developer accountability? 🟢 RBI Purchases ₹3,472 Cr Land in South Mumbai The Reserve Bank of India acquires a 4.2-acre parcel in Nariman Point from MMRCL, marking one of South Mumbai’s largest single land deals ever. How will this landmark deal influence the city’s land market and future commercial projects? 🟢 H1B Visa Fee Increase The US government introduces a USD 1,00,000 fee for new H1B visa petitions, effective September 21, 2025, targeting misuse of the program. In this episode, Abhay Rao & Balaji Rao share insights on 2 major updates shaping India’s real estate market: 🟢 Record Office Leasing in H1 2025 India’s office market has set a new benchmark with 48.9 million sq ft leased across major cities. Bengaluru tops the charts with 18.2M sq ft, driven by companies like TCS and a growing talent pool. What does this mean for commercial growth and long-term market prospects? 🟢 MahaRERA Digital Verification The Maharashtra State Registration Department is integrating its property registration system with MahaRERA, enabling sub-registrars to verify developers’ RERA registration numbers in real time. Hear from real estate experts Abhay Rao and Balaji Rao in this week’s Real Estate News Round-Up with Prop News Time. -- In this episode, we cover 3 major updates shaping India’s real estate market right now — with insights from Abhay Rao & Balaji Rao: 🟢 GST 2.0 Reforms: Impact on Real Estate GST rates on key construction materials like cement, steel, and marble have been cut. Will this reduce construction costs — and will buyers see lower property prices? 🟢 Indian Railways Land Lease in Mumbai The Railways plans to lease 273 acres across the city through the RLDA, including prime plots in Mahalaxmi and Bandra. Could this unlock new supply and stabilize land prices in India’s costliest city? 🟢 NHB RESIDEX: Housing Prices Stabilize Housing prices rose in 45 of 50 tracked cities, but growth has moderated to 5.7% YoY. Watch this week’s real estate round-up for key insights on the trends shaping India’s property market. -- In this episode of Prop News Time’s Real Estate News Round-Up, we explore two major stories reshaping real estate in 2025: 🟢 Land Deals Hit New Highs In just the first half of 2025, 76 land transactions spanning nearly 2,900 acres were finalized across India — surpassing the total for all of 2024. The Mumbai Metropolitan Region (MMR) led the charge, followed by Bengaluru and Pune. ▶ Why are developers focusing on metros? ▶ Is this a sign of long-term confidence or short-term positioning? 🟢 Plot Sales Continue to Climb Over 45,000 residential plots were launched in the first half of 2025 alone, with hotspots like OMR (Chennai), Sarjapura (Bengaluru), Alibaug, and Dapoli drawing attention. ▶ What’s fuelling this demand? ▶ Are buyers driven by lifestyle, speculation—or smart marketing?
